How We Rank Schools

Every school list on this site is ordered by the BOC Score, computed from the most recent school-level data published by the U.S. Department of Education (College Scorecard and IPEDS). To qualify, a school must be currently operating and accredited by an agency recognized by the U.S. Department of Education. Each eligible school is then scored on five measures, percentile-ranked against schools at the same credential level:

  • Graduation rate 30%
  • Median earnings, 10 years after entry 25%
  • Average net price (lower is better) 20%
  • Retention rate 15%
  • Fully online availability 10%

Schools without enough outcome data appear after ranked schools, without a score. On this page, schools are ordered by distance from Jackson. Advertising never affects these rankings. Read the full methodology.

Sociology Wages Near Jackson

Jackson is part of the Jackson, MS metro area (BLS area code 27140).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to Mississippi statewide.

Occupation Median Wage Source COL-Adjusted (US=100)
Sociologists N/A MS statewide
Sociology Teachers, Postsecondary $70,860 MS statewide $79,618
Social and Human Service Assistants $31,270 Jackson, MS $35,135
Survey Researchers N/A MS statewide
Child, Family, and School Social Workers $46,610 Jackson, MS $52,371
Market Research Analysts and Marketing Specialists $60,310 Jackson, MS $67,764
Social Science Research Assistants N/A MS statewide
Social and Community Service Managers $71,470 Jackson, MS $80,303

Source: BLS, May 2025 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.
